Roles & Responsibilities
- Assess speech, language, cognitive-communication and swallowing abilities to create a clear baseline for care
- Develop and implement individualized treatment plans that drive measurable progress
- Provide skilled therapy services and adjust interventions based on patient response
- Collaborate with nurses, therapists and family members to coordinate holistic care
- Document evaluations, plans and progress thoroughly and timely
- Educate patients and caregivers to empower meaningful carryover outside of sessions
